Atlanta Sprinter van service is private group transportation using a chauffeured Sprinter-style van or comparable high-roof passenger vehicle supplied by a vetted licensed local operator. It is useful when passenger count, luggage, airport pickup rules, PDK handoff details, event staging, and one-vehicle coordination matter more than simply ordering separate sedans or SUVs. It is not a self-drive van rental product.

A full Executive Sprinter may not fit every suitcase. Airport, wedding, family, and convention requests should list checked bags, carry-ons, garment bags, instruments, booth material, and equipment.
Jet Sprinters fit smaller premium groups; Executive Sprinters fit more people but can leave less luggage room. The quote should state the intended configuration.
A direct ATL-to-hotel group transfer can be point-to-point. Events, weddings, dinners, private aviation holds, and convention programs often need hourly structure.
Sprinter supply tightens around World Cup 2026, Mercedes-Benz Stadium events, GWCC conventions, major wedding weekends, and high-volume ATL arrival banks.

| — Option | — Pricing | — Best for | — Weakness |
|---|---|---|---|
| Private Sprinter service | Emailed quote based on configuration, route, passengers, luggage, wait policy, airport, event, and timing | Confirmed group fit, luggage fit, airport handoff, executive movement, private aviation, conventions, and event returns | Higher cost floor than splitting into public transit, taxi, shuttle, or app rides |
| Two or three SUVs | Multiple vehicle quotes with separate minimums, wait, and staging rules | Groups with principals, luggage overflow, or split timing | Coordination can be harder when passengers need to move together |
| Ride app vans | Dynamic app pricing with pickup and wait variables | Flexible small groups with light luggage and no need for advance vehicle-class confirmation | Vehicle fit, pickup point, price, and wait experience can vary at airports and events |
| MARTA or shuttle | Lower public or shared-ride cost when the route works | Light-luggage groups near rail or shuttle access | Not door-to-door and weaker for luggage, formal arrivals, private aviation, or event release |

The trade is cabin versus capacity. A Jet Sprinter gives a smaller group — roughly eight to ten depending on layout — premium cabin space, which suits corporate teams and PDK private aviation arrivals. An Executive Sprinter seats ten to fourteen but leaves less luggage room at full load, so airport groups with checked bags should state both counts so the quote can flag overflow early.

A wedding Sprinter quote works backward from the timeline: ceremony and reception locations, the hotel, photo stops, and the pickup sequence for the party, plus a return plan for the end of the night. Garment bags count against luggage space, so list them with passenger count, and name the group lead who handles day-of changes.
Often not at full load. Twelve to fourteen seated passengers can leave too little room for every checked bag, which is why the quote asks for bag counts before seat counts. When the math is tight, a Sprinter plus SUV support vehicle or a multi-vehicle plan moves the same ATL arrival group without leaving luggage behind.
Use a Sprinter plus SUV when the group has full passenger count, airport luggage, golf bags, presentation material, principals who need a separate vehicle, or split timing between ATL, PDK, Buckhead, Midtown, and event venues.
